Human Resource Coordinator

Location - Shannon, County Clare, Ireland

New Role - Closing Date: 1st October 2025

About the Role

This is an excellent opportunity for a motivated and experienced HR professional to join our team on a part time basis. Reporting to the Chief People Officer, the HR Coordinator will play a key role in supporting all aspects of HR operations, including recruitment, learning and development (L&D), personnel administration, and maintaining our vibrant company culture.

The ideal candidate will be self-motivated, trustworthy, and experienced in working in a fast-paced environment. They will be responsible for managing HR processes, supporting employees and line managers, and ensuring the smooth operation of our HR functions.

Key Responsabilities

  • Assist with the day-to-day operations of HR functions and handle administrative tasks.
  • Manage, support, and improve HR-related processes to enhance efficiency.
  • Compile, update, and maintain accurate employee records.
  • Oversee employee relations and provide support to resolve workplace issues.
  • Coordinate HR projects, including meetings, training sessions, and employee engagement initiatives.
  • Process employee requests, such as leave applications, in a timely manner.
  • Update and maintain the HR Locker system to ensure data accuracy.
  • Assist with business and office insurance renewals.
  • Ad hoc duties to assist with the facility.
  • Data protection duties.
  • Ensure compliance by monitoring and managing company policies.

Requirements

  • Experience: At least 2 years of work experience as an HR Coordinator, or similar role.
  • Knowledge: A solid understanding of employment law and HR best practices.
  • Technical Skills: Proficiency in Microsoft Office and Google Suite.
  • Soft Skills: Strong organisational, administrative, attention to detail and interpersonal skills.
  • Attitude: A proactive, self-motivated approach with the ability to work independently and collaboratively.

Desired Qualifications

  • Certification in HR (e.g., CIPD).
  • Business acumen and an understanding of HR’s role in supporting organisational goals.
  • Data literacy and the ability to analyse HR metrics.
  • People advocacy and a passion for supporting employee well-being.
